From: David S. Miller Date: Tue, 18 Oct 2016 18:14:22 +0000 (-0400) Subject: Merge branch 'smc91x-dt' X-Git-Url: https://git.stricted.de/?a=commitdiff_plain;h=7cafb0ba141e4836604b1c3b35ed6e7a15448d7b;p=GitHub%2Fmoto-9609%2Fandroid_kernel_motorola_exynos9610.git Merge branch 'smc91x-dt' Robert Jarzmik says: ==================== support smc91x on mainstone and devicetree This series aims at bringing support to mainstone board on a device-tree based build, as what is already in place for legacy mainstone. The bulk of the mainstone "specific" behavior is that a u16 write doesn't work on a address of the form 4*n + 2, while it works on 4*n. The legacy workaround was in SMC_outw(), with calls to machine_is_mainstone(). These calls don't work with a pxa27x-dt machine type, which is used when a generic device-tree pxa27x machine is used to boot the mainstone board. Therefore, this series enables the smc91c111 adapter of the mainstone board to work on a device-tree build, exaclty as it's been working for years with the legacy arch/arm/mach-pxa/mainstone.c definition. As a sum up, this extends an existing mechanism to device-tree based pxa platforms. ==================== Signed-off-by: David S. Miller --- 7cafb0ba141e4836604b1c3b35ed6e7a15448d7b